Job Summary

Assists with the management of patient / athlete visits within the clinic performing a range of clinical responsibilities in support of the physicians.

Participates in community outreach and conducts presentations on a variety of Athletic Training Topics. Supervises Student Athletic Trainers and / or Intern Athletic Trainers and mentors new staff members.

Accountabilities

Interaction and management of patient visit within clinic for physician - 75%

  • Interacts regularly with patients and others involved in the patient / athlete's care to incorporate an interdisciplinary treatment approach for coordinated quality care
  • Obtains initial patient history, vital signs, and / or follow up status and presents to physician in preparation for their exam of patient / athlete
  • Request and organization of ancillary studies (X-rays, MRI, CT scans, lab work, etc.) and presentation for physician for their review
  • Preparation of patient for physician arrival, injection, or other office procedure specific to each physician preference
  • Preparation of injection or other office procedure specific to each physician preference
  • Post-operative dressing changes, staple or suture removal as directed by physician
  • Instruction to patient to post-operative or post-injury wound care or dressing care
  • Performance of knee ligament laxity or other joint tests or measurements upon direction of the physician
  • Organization and disbursement of patient lab work or other office tests as directed
  • Application and removal of casts, splints, etc. as directed by physician
  • Patient instruction on proper care of casts, splints, etc.
  • Patient instruction upon discharge for physical therapy, further studies, follow up appointments and direction for patients as they leave the clinic
  • Teaches, counsels and communicates with patients, athletes, their families, coaches and others to achieve the desired outcomes
  • Interacts with patients, athletes, coaches, families and colleagues to enlist their informed cooperation in establishing programs to insure the safe return to play of that athlete or activity of the patient
  • Supports and provides educational material to athletes, coaches, parents, community at large on injury management and prevention
  • Participates in follow-up care once the patient / athlete is ready to return to play or their desired activity
  • Provides information regarding follow-up services which may include a referral to other Prisma Health / community resources (such as MD)
  • Complies with departmental policies for documentation
  • Responsible for taking office notes when directed by physicians
  • Responsible for organization and disbursement of incoming medical records, reports, etc. as they arrive at the clinic
  • Report of patients / athletes sent to MD, follow-up services ordered and where the service was performed, MRI, etc.

Minimum Hiring Requirements

South Carolina DHEC Athletic Training Certificate required.

National Athletic Trainers Association Board of Certification (NATABOC) required.

No experience is required.

Other Required Skills and Experience

Requires a high level of physical activity and endurance as constant movement and frequent heavy lifting are required - Required
